Overview
The Wingara Project at Waverley College’s Junior Campus is a challenging yet rewarding project. The site location, characterized by overgrown jungle terrain and steep inclines, is also home to two century-old Moreton Bay Figs.
The school’s objective with this project is to rejuvenate the area with a vision of creating a fun and engaging space for the students to relish for years to come.
The project design includes a number of raised boardwalks, learning platforms, native landscaping and climbing structures. Our skilled and innovative team of designers and consultants have made innovative and collaborative decisions to successfully bring this difficult project to fruition.
